A classic and aesthetic combination specimen from the long extinct Park City District of Utah. This classy two-sided piece features a mounded cluster of sharp, moderately lustrous, gun-metal gray, tetrahedral tetrahedrite crystals. A vug in the large crystal on the back is filled with mirror-bright, brass-yellow pyrite pyritohedrons. Complete-all-around on top. Just a tiny bit of bruising is noted to a couple of crystal tips. The periphery wear at the base is noted by the pyrite vug. Seldom seen material from this noted locality and even rarer, as the particular mine is even known. This is a very fine old-time specimen from this district. Ex Claude Yoder Collection.
